Water and Dust Resistance

Water and dust resistance is an integral aspect of Realme phones, ensuring that they can withstand environmental challenges. Many models are designed with an IP (Ingress Protection) rating, which indicates their effectiveness against water and dust intrusion. For instance, a phone rated IP67 can survive immersion in water up to 1 meter deep for 30 minutes, while also being fully protected against dust.

The construction materials play a significant role in achieving this resistance. Realme typically utilizes reinforced glass and strong casing, which not only offers aesthetic appeal but also safeguards internal components from dust particles and moisture exposure. This robust design is essential for increasing the phone’s longevity, particularly in varying weather conditions.

Water Resistance Tests

Water resistance tests evaluate how well Realme phones can withstand exposure to moisture, assessing their ability to function correctly after being submerged in water or exposed to rain. These tests adhere to established international standards, driving consumer confidence in the product.

Typically, manufacturers utilize the Ingress Protection (IP) rating system to classify water resistance levels. For instance, a Realme phone rated IP67 can survive submersion in up to one meter of water for 30 minutes. Key factors considered during these assessments include:

  • Duration of immersion
  • Depth of water exposure
  • Frequency and nature of exposure to water

Realme conducts rigorous tests to ensure its devices meet or exceed claimed ratings, often simulating real-world scenarios. User scenarios include accidental drops in pools or exposure to rain, ensuring that the phones remain operational under various conditions. Maintenance Tips for Enhancing Phone Durability

To prolong the lifespan of Realme phones and enhance their durability, it is important to adopt effective maintenance practices. Regular cleaning is essential; dust and dirt can accumulate in ports and crevices, which may hinder performance. Use a microfiber cloth to wipe the screen and body, ensuring it remains free from smudges and scratches.

Utilizing a protective case is another significant strategy. Cases designed specifically for Realme phones provide a buffer against drops and impacts. In addition to cases, investing in a screen protector can help guard against scratches and cracks, preserving the device’s display integrity.

Avoiding extreme temperatures is vital as well. Exposure to excessive heat or cold can damage internal components. Keeping the phone in a stable environment minimizes the risk of overheating or other temperature-related issues. Lastly, charging the phone using the manufacturer’s recommended charger ensures the battery remains in optimal condition, further boosting overall durability.
